下载 gkeadm

本文档介绍如何下载 gkeadm 命令行工具,该工具用于为 GKE on VMware 创建管理员工作站。

通常,您唯一必须手动下载的组件就是 gkeadm。 在某些情况下,您可能需要手动下载以下一个或多个其他组件:

  • 管理员工作站开放虚拟化设备 (OVA)
  • GKE on VMware 软件包
  • gkectl 命令行工具

如需了解详情,请参阅下载

准备工作

您必须使用 Google 账号登录。

要查看您是否已登录,请查看您的 SDK account 属性

gcloud config get-value account

如要登录,请按以下步骤操作:

gcloud auth login

下载“gkeadm

使用 gkeadm 命令行工具创建管理员工作站。然后,建立与管理员工作站的 SSH 连接,并通过管理员工作站创建集群。

gkeadm 命令行工具适用于 64 位的 Linux。

gkeadm 也适用于 macOS 10.15 及更高版本、Windows 10 和 Windows Server 2019。不过,对 macOS 和 Windows 的支持已被弃用,并将在未来的版本中移除。

Linux

gsutil cp gs://gke-on-prem-release/gkeadm/VERSION/linux/gkeadm ./
chmod +x gkeadm

Windows

gsutil cp gs://gke-on-prem-release/gkeadm/VERSION/windows/gkeadm.exe ./

macOS Catalina

gsutil cp gs://gke-on-prem-release/gkeadm/VERSION/darwin/gkeadm ./
chmod +x gkeadm

VERSION 替换为您要将集群安装或升级到的 GKE on VMware 版本。最新的可用补丁版本是 1.16.8-gke.19。如需查看可用版本的列表,请参阅版本历史记录

使用 openssl 验证 gkeadm

您可以使用 openssl 对照公钥验证 gkeadm 二进制文件。

gsutil cp gs://gke-on-prem-release/gkeadm/VERSION/linux/gkeadm.1.sig /tmp/gkeadm.1.sig
echo "-----BEGIN PUBLIC KEY-----
MFkwEwYHKoZIzj0CAQYIKoZIzj0DAQcDQgAEWZrGCUaJJr1H8a36sG4UUoXvlXvZ
wQfk16sxprI2gOJ2vFFggdq3ixF2h4qNBt0kI7ciDhgpwS8t+/960IsIgw==
-----END PUBLIC KEY-----" > key.pem
openssl dgst -verify key.pem -signature /tmp/gkeadm.1.sig ./gkeadm

此命令的预期输出为 Verified OK